Ingredients You’ll Need
For the Creamy Filling:
-
2 blocks (8 oz each) cream cheese, softened
-
½ cup sour cream
-
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
-
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
-
7 to 8 flour tortillas (8-inch size)
For the Churro-Style Coating:
-
½ cup salted butter, melted
-
1 cup granulated sugar
-
2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Make the Cheesecake Filling
In a large mixing bowl, blend together the softened cream cheese, sour cream, sugar, and vanilla extract. Mix until everything is smooth, fluffy, and creamy.
Step 2: Fill and Roll
Warm each tortilla in the microwave for about 10 seconds to make them easier to roll. Spread roughly ⅓ cup of the cheesecake mixture across one end of the tortilla. Roll tightly into a taquito shape, keeping the ends open.
Step 3: Add the Churro Magic
Melt the butter in a bowl. In a separate shallow dish, stir together the cinnamon and sugar. Dip each rolled tortilla into the butter, ensuring it’s completely coated. Then roll it in the cinnamon-sugar mixture until evenly covered.
Step 4: Bake to Perfection
Place your coated taquitos seam-side down on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the edges are golden and crisp.
Step 5: Serve and Enjoy
Let them cool for about 5 minutes (if you can wait!). Serve warm, topped with fresh strawberries, a dollop of whipped cream, a drizzle of chocolate or caramel—anything your sweet tooth desires.

Pro Tips
-
Room-temperature cream cheese blends easier and avoids lumps.
-
For extra crunch, broil the taquitos for the last 1–2 minutes (watch closely!).
-
Store leftovers (if there are any!) in an airtight container in the fridge, and reheat in the oven to crisp them back up.
